Battery

My battery in my car won't stay charged...you can run the car all day long and the next morning the darn battery is dead again and have to hook the jump box on it, its a good battery and the alternater is working fine, but will not stay charged.

Check to see if anything is left on, like the hatch light or something. Also, you have anything hooked up to the lighter, like a radar detector? I know in my 91 it's hot at all times, so I have to physically unplug it everytime I turn off the car.

How many times has the battery drained itself? You may want to replace again if its done it many times.
